Post-Tropical Cyclone Adrian Discussion Number 8
NWS National Hurricane Center Miami FL EP012017
1000 AM CDT Thu May 11 2017
Adrian consists of a rather insignificant-looking swirl of low
clouds with just a few isolated showers. The system has been
devoid of significant deep convection since yesterday afternoon, so
it is being declared a remnant low on this advisory.
The initial motion estimate is again 315/6 kt. The post-tropical
cyclone is likely to turn toward the west-northwest to the south of
a weak mid-level ridge over the next couple of days, and meander
within weak steering flow to the south of Mexico later in the
forecast period.
This is the last advisory on Adrian unless regeneration occurs.For additional information on the remnant low please see High Seas
